Community of practice

The organizational development (OD) concept of a community of practice (abbreviated as CoP) refers to the process of social learning that occurs when people in organizations, who have a common interest in some subject or problem, collaborate to share ideas, find solutions, and build innovations.

A wiki (such as Wikipedia.org) can be thought of as a virtual CoP.

The first person to develop the CoP term was theorist Etienne Wenger. http://www.ewenger.com/
